Lidgren.Network.NetIncomingMessage.ReadUInt16 C# (CSharp) Méthode

ReadUInt16() public méthode

Reads a 16 bit unsigned integer written using Write(UInt16)
public ReadUInt16 ( ) : UInt16
Résultat System.UInt16
        public UInt16 ReadUInt16()
        {
            NetException.Assert(m_bitLength - m_readPosition >= 16, c_readOverflowError);
            uint retval = NetBitWriter.ReadUInt32(m_data, 16, m_readPosition);
            m_readPosition += 16;
            return (ushort)retval;
        }

Usage Example

Exemple #1
0
 protected override void Read(NetIncomingMessage message)
 {
     x = message.ReadFloat();
     y = message.ReadFloat();
     rotation = message.ReadUInt16().FromNetworkRotation() * (180f / (float)Math.PI);
     type = message.ReadByte();
 }
All Usage Examples Of Lidgren.Network.NetIncomingMessage::ReadUInt16